Kwankwaso Commends Tinubu for Kano Airport Funding

Kwankwaso Commends Tinubu for Kano Airport Funding

Alhaji (Dr.) Iliyasu Musa Kwankwaso, a chieftain of the All Progressives Congress (APC) and Director of Finance at the Hadejia Jama’are River Basin Development Authority (HJRBDA), praised President Bola Ahmed Tinubu for the Federal Government’s approval of ₦46 billion for the resurfacing and reconstruction of the second runway at the Mallam Aminu Kano International Airport. Kwankwaso described the approval as a demonstration of Tinubu's commitment to the development of Northern Nigeria, stating it would enhance commercial activities in the region.

He urged Northerners to recognize positive government initiatives, regardless of political affiliations. Kwankwaso also acknowledged the contributions of key figures, including Dr.

Abdullahi Umar Ganduje and Festus Keyamo, in securing the approval. Keyamo announced that 60% of the contract sum has been released, and work has commenced on the project, which aims to modernize the airport and reinforce its status as a major aviation hub for Northern Nigeria.
